In the field of material science and engineering, understanding the properties of materials is crucial for various applications. One important property that often comes into play is the average particle diameter. The average particle diameter refers to the mean size of particles in a given sample. This measurement can significantly affect the physical and chemical behavior of materials, influencing their reactivity, strength, and other characteristics. For instance, in the pharmaceutical industry, the average particle diameter of drug particles can impact the rate of dissolution and absorption in the body, which in turn affects the efficacy of the medication. Similarly, in the field of nanotechnology, the average particle diameter determines how materials interact at the nanoscale, which can lead to innovative applications in electronics, medicine, and materials engineering.To accurately measure the average particle diameter, various techniques are employed, such as laser diffraction, dynamic light scattering, and microscopy. Each method has its own advantages and limitations, and the choice of technique often depends on the specific requirements of the study or application. For example, laser diffraction is commonly used for larger particles, while dynamic light scattering is more suited for smaller nanoparticles. Regardless of the method used, obtaining a precise measurement of the average particle diameter is essential for ensuring the quality and performance of the final product.Moreover, the average particle diameter can also be influenced by factors such as the manufacturing process, the nature of the raw materials, and environmental conditions. For instance, processes like milling or grinding can reduce the particle size, thus affecting the average particle diameter of the resulting powder. In contrast, processes like agglomeration can increase the average particle diameter, leading to different material properties. Understanding these relationships is vital for engineers and scientists who aim to design materials with specific characteristics.In conclusion, the average particle diameter is a fundamental concept in material science that plays a critical role in determining the behavior and functionality of various materials. By measuring and controlling the average particle diameter, researchers and engineers can tailor materials to meet specific needs across various industries. Whether in pharmaceuticals, nanotechnology, or construction, the significance of the average particle diameter cannot be overstated, as it directly influences the performance and effectiveness of products we rely on every day.
